Neil Sissons - Artistic Director
Neil was born in Sheffield and studied drama at Bretton Hall College and Leeds University. After a short period as assistant to the Drama Advisor for Sheffield and as an actor, he co-founded Compass in 1981 to produce The Collector on the Edinburgh Fringe. Neil has directed all the Company’s work to date, and under his guidance the company has grown from its tiny profit-share beginnings into one of the UK’s foremost touring theatre companies.
He has also written for the Company; his new plays include Damocles and The Last Executioner in collaboration with Paul Rider and Refugees, Moonstomp and A Higher Passion with Nick Chadwin. Neil and Nick have also translated Henrik Ibsen's A Doll's House and adapted The Wind in the Willows, A Christmas Carol and Jekyll & Hyde - all performed by Compass. In 2004 Neil translated Chekhov’s The Evils of Tobacco and The Proposal, which were both performed by Compass.
Outside the Company, for a number of years Neil was an associate director of Hull Truck Theatre Company. His work for them includes Toad Of Toad Hall, The Lion, the Witch and The Wardrobe and A Hard Day's Night, and West End productions of Bouncers and Teechers.
He has pursued a variety of further freelance writing and directing projects. He lives in Sheffield with his wife, Bea, and has a daughter, Kitty.
Craig Dronfield - General Manager
Craig joined Compass after working for Opera Circus, Actors Touring Company, Cross Border Arts, the Post Office and Enos Kaye Wholesale Fruitiers.
Richard Rawson - Admin Assistant
Richard Rawson is the Company’s Administrative Assistant.
Richard joined the company in March 2007. After obtaining an English Degree at Anglia Ruskins University, Cambridge campus, Richard pursed his passion to work in theatre.
Previously, Richard worked as a Production Assistant for Sheffield Theatres, providing administrative support for their in-house productions and with their visiting company programme.
Richard is looking forward to working as a member of an exciting touring theatre company, and working with the wide variety of venues Compass tours to around the country.
Dan Franklin - Production Team
Dan studied at Jesus College, Oxford and The Royal Welsh College of Music and Drama.
Dan has worked for Compass on eight shows; The Price, Hard Times (2006), Moby Dick, The Seagull, The Rivals, The Winter’s Tale, Waiting for Godot and Hard Times (2000).
Recent productions for other companies include Long Time Dead and After the End (Paines Plough) Bridgetower (English Touring Opera);PUSH! (Tête à Tête Opera); To Kill a Mockingbird (Mercury Theatre, Colchester); Bent, Peeling and George Dandin (Graeae Theatre Company); The Lion and The Jewel, Sense of Belonging and a Nigerian adaptation of Lorca’s Yerma (Collective Artists); Rome and Jewels (UK Arts International); Out of Our Heads (Actors' Touring Company); and several pantomimes (The Theatre, Chipping Norton).
